Sustainable Bus Service for the residents of the Coombe Road and Meadowview areas

We the undersigned petition Brighton & Hove Council to enable the provision of a satisfactory and sustainable bus service for the residents of the Coombe Road and Meadowview areas of the city.

This service should:

1. Run regularly, at least every 30 minutes, from 7:00am until 11.30 pm every day, including weekends and bank holidays.

2. Follow a common-sense route and a route passengers want to take; at a minimum a shuttle service connecting our area with all other Lewes Road bus services, or a longer service - to Churchill Square, Brighton station or London Road, returning the same route.

3. The Citywide live bus display and mobile app system must include this service.

This area, with a population of around 5,000 residents within three miles of the city centre, is suffering from a 50% reduction in bus services with evening services reduced to one bus every 75 minutes. Meadowview is a mile from Lewes Road and can only be accessed via a steep hill. This impacts negatively on the lives of residents, many of whom have young families or are elderly or disabled, with no other means of transport.

This ePetition ran from 24/12/2015 to 11/02/2016 and has now finished.

475 people signed this ePetition.

Council response

Will be presented to the Environment, Transport & Sustainability Committee meeting on 15 March 2016
